Standard setting of controller (programmed RESET of controller) - in case of any problems with setting of
the parameters it is possible with pressing both SW1 and SW2 at the same time and then switching power on to
set the standard parameters.
Controller setting procedure:
The initialization routine starts at the switched-on controller, zero system deviation and short pressing of the
SW1 button for ca 2 sec (i.e. until the diode D3 got on). Loosing the button some of the default menus starts
(usually control signal) what is shown with 1 blink on the D3 diode as well as one of the default parameters
(usually control signal of 4-20mA) what is shown with 1 blink on the D4 diode. Then the required parameters of
the controller can be changed according to Table 2:
• press shortly the SW1 button to list the menu shown with the blinking number on the D4 diode.
• press shortly the SW2 button to set parameters shown with the blinking number on the D4 diode.
After changing of the parameters according to user's wishes, put the controller to autocalibration with
pressing the SW1 button for ca 2 sec (i.e. until the diode D3 got on). During this process the controller performs
the feedback transmitter and turning sense checking, sets actuator to the positions "open" and "closed",
measures inertia mass in the directions "opening" and "closing", and loads the adjusted parameters into the
EEPROM memory. In case that during the initialization process an error occurs (e.g. in connection or
adjustment) the initialization process will be interrupted and the controller with the D4 diode reports about the
type of the error. Else after finishing the initialization process the controller is put into the regulation mode.
Error messages of the controller with D4 diode at initialization
4 blinks.........improper connection of the torque switches
5 blinks.........improper connection of the feedback transmitter
8 blinks.........bad sense of actuator's turning direction or adverse connection of the feedback
transmitter
4.7.2 Watching operation and error states
Watching operation and error states is possible with the EA open.
a) Operation status with the D3 LED diode indicating:
• it is continuously lighting - the controller regulates
• it is continuously not lighting - system deviation in the insensitiveness range - the EA has stopped
